没有合适的资源?快使用搜索试试~ 我知道了~
FPGA设计工具及硬件简介.docx
1.该资源内容由用户上传,如若侵权请联系客服进行举报
2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
版权申诉
0 下载量 42 浏览量
2022-11-02
18:54:28
上传
评论
收藏 12KB DOCX 举报
温馨提示
试读
3页
。。。
资源推荐
资源详情
资源评论
FPGA 设计工具及硬件简介
1 QUARTUS II 概述
在本次设计中采用了 QUARTUS II 作为了开发平台,QUARTUS II 属于综合
性较强的PLD 开发软件,软件支持多种输入形式,包括原理图、AHDL、VHDL
等多种设计输入形式。该软件内部装有仿真器以及综合器,这就便于系统可以有
效进行设计输入,合理安排硬件配置,完成较为完整的 PLD 设计流程。此开发
软件在使用平台上不受限制,可以在XP、Unix 和 Linux 上进行使用,为软件用
户提供图形界面,完成整个设计流程,在用户体验上,运行速度快、功能较为集
中,操作性能强。
第一,首先要将所要求的设计项目进行划分,将项目区分为多个板块,建立
新的目标,并将各个模块进行单独存放,然后对模板进行独立的编译工作,在编
译工作结束后,通过验证有效后,将单独的子模块的 VHDL 的文本文件按照要
求存储到总工程的文件夹中去,接着建立图元,最后将各个图元相互连接,来建
立新的设计目标。
第二,各个子模块在划分之后,独立的子模块在被编写代码之后,验证通过
得出的 VHDL 软件就会被添加到总设计的顶层文件之中,就像第一步所展示的
那样,图元的连接完成了新项目的设计。这部分就是将管脚连好。考虑到原理图
的设计时,默认连接节点处名字相同的节点,不区分大小写,图形编辑时,在窗
口显示的粗线表示整个设计中的主线,在这里比需要注意的是,总线的名称必须
加上英文标志,也就是含有节点的编号,在原理图的设计时,要注意文件的扩展
名,这要注意到工程名和在顶层的实体名称保持一致,以便与之后的编译工作。
第三,进行功能仿真,这时要注意仿真文件的扩展名,这也就是常说的前仿
真,而后仿真则是指时序仿真,整个仿真过程中需要忽略由于延时导致的数据误
差,也是较为理想的仿真程序,后者考虑到了延时的仿真,仿真结果趋近于实际
的仿真结果。总体上来说,要保证仿真过程中,要考虑到逻辑思维的准确性,保
证仿真符合总体设计要求,默认程序上要选择时序仿真,便于在设置好各个环节
的功能,由此来形成仿真网络表。
2 FPGA 简介
FPGA 也就是现场可编程门阵列的意思,它通常由可配置逻辑模块,输入输
出模块,内部连线等组成。FPGA 与通用的其他单片机来比,其最大的区别就是
它是并行运行的,所以其速度是远飞其他的处理器可以比的,而与专用ASIC 电
资源评论
G11176593
- 粉丝: 6674
- 资源: 3万+
上传资源 快速赚钱
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- n.cpp
- jdk-8u411-windows-x64下载安装可用
- vgg模型-图像分类算法对水果识别-不含数据集图片-含逐行注释和说明文档.zip
- KMP算法(Knuth-Morris-Pratt算法
- vgg模型-python语言pytorch框架训练识别化妆品分类-不含数据集图片-含逐行注释和说明文档.zip
- KMP算法(Knuth-Morris-Pratt算法
- shufflenet模型-基于人工智能的卷积网络训练识别狗的表情-不含数据集图片-含逐行注释和说明文档.zip
- shufflenet模型-python语言pytorch框架训练识别张嘴闭嘴-不含数据集图片-含逐行注释和说明文档.zip
- resnet模型-基于人工智能的卷积网络训练识别面部表情识别-不含数据集图片-含逐行注释和说明文档
- resnet模型-python语言pytorch框架训练识别香蕉品质-不含数据集图片-含逐行注释和说明文档.zip
资源上传下载、课程学习等过程中有任何疑问或建议,欢迎提出宝贵意见哦~我们会及时处理!
点击此处反馈
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功